Output 92b3d129ee3266cd54f410768e89d0f1dfe4b42bbfdbf8b33cd98e58d8f08836:0

value
23622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b5bfeb54bf65c1c63757730c2675fc1221da6a OP_EQUAL
address
3PMuoCP62qQogKUortnFFfVqtTMW7m2pzz
transaction
92b3d129ee3266cd54f410768e89d0f1dfe4b42bbfdbf8b33cd98e58d8f08836
spent
true